Before buying new pallets, companies must consider several factors that can significantly impact their choice:

Load Capacity: Analyze the weight of the products you intend to transport and guarantee the pallets can deal with the load.

Pallet Size: Standard sizes are usually 48"x40", but companies might require customized sizes depending on their requirements.

Material: Determine the very best material based upon the particular usage case-- analyze the environment and product nature.

Resilience Requirements: Consider how often pallets will be reused and the conditions they will face, such as exposure to moisture or chemicals.

Regulatory Compliance: Some industries need pallets to fulfill specific regulations (e.g., ISPM 15 for wooden pallets).

Expense: New pallets can differ considerably in rate; it's crucial to evaluate your budget plan while making sure quality.

How do I know what size pallet I need?
Response: The size of the pallet depends on your item measurements and storage areas. Requirement sizes are commonly readily available, however it's best to determine your products and storage area initially.
2. What is the typical lifespan of a wooden pallet?
Response: Wooden pallets can last anywhere from 4-8 years if correctly maintained, while new pallets designed for multiple usages can last even longer.
3. Can I purchase custom-made pallets?
Answer: Yes, many providers use the alternative to design custom pallets. It's advisable to discuss your specific requirements with your supplier.
4. Are plastic pallets worth the investment?
Response: Yes, while initially more costly, plastic pallets use durability, much easier upkeep, and prospective cost savings in the long run due to lower replacement costs.
